Ohio's free fishing weekend is June 14-15, allowing all Ohioans to fish public waters without a license. All fishing regulations, except licensing, remain in effect during the free fishing weekend.
Colorado's Free Fishing Weekend is June 7-8 this year, allowing anyone to fish without a license. The event encourages people to explore Colorado's outdoors and try fishing throughout the state.

Saturday is Idaho’s Free Fishing Day and the Upper Snake Region is celebrating by loaning poles and bait at Jim Moore Pond, near Roberts, and Trail Creek Pond, near Victor.

The Michigan Department of Natural Resources is reminding people that "Three Free" weekend will take place Saturday, June 7, and Sunday, June 8, all across the state.
